I applied online.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at Shopify in Oct 2021
Interview
1. Initial screening - talking about your "life story" with HR/recruiter. Going over resume/experience, interest in company/industry, career goals, etc.
2. 1h15m Peer programming exercise on CoderPad (in python). I was paired with a current data scientist and worked through an analysis problem on a small data set. I discussed my approach, coded the solution, and tried test cases. It was fairly relaxed/not too stressful and he actually stepped in and helped at minor points when I got stuck.
3. Supposedly there's another technical interview/panel interview (possibly) but I didn't get past the first stage.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Given a list of (date, duration) tuples, how would you filter by time period and calculate summary stats (average, rolling sum)?
